Hey everyone. Auburn's first-round opponent in the SEC Tournament has been determined and you may be happy about it.
The league's hottest team, led by John Pawlowski, will play the Crimson Tide on Wednesday morning beginning 9:30 a.m. That'll take place in Hoover, Ala., at Regions Park Stadium.
Auburn beat Ole Miss on Saturday, 11-1. The completed a series sweep.

ReplyDeletehere are the match-ups for wednesday in hoover:
ReplyDeleteWednesday, May 26
Game 1: 10:30 a.m. #7 Alabama vs. #2 Auburn [SPSO]
Game 2: TBD #6 Ole Miss vs. #3 South Carolina [SPSO]
Game 3: 5:30 p.m. #8 LSU vs. #1 Florida [CSS]
Game 4: TBD #5 Vanderbilt vs. #4 Arkansas [CSS]
